问题错误:&QUOT;访问路径&LT;路径&GT;被拒绝&QUOT。 [英] Problems with error: "Access to the path <path> is denied."
问题描述
我一直在寻找的伎俩来解决这个错误(谷歌,stackoverflow.com等),每一个没有什么作品。
我需要动态地创建通过asp.net应用程序.aspx文件。
I was looking for the the trick to resolve that error (google, stackoverflow.com etc) and every nothing works. I need to dynamically create an .aspx file via the asp.net application.
我所做的尝试修复它:
1)在文件夹的属性 - >安全,我已经添加IUSR_TONY也IIS_IUSRS,让他们完全控制到该文件夹。只是为了检查是否会有所帮助。不,不会。
1) In the folder's Properties -> Security, I've added IUSR_TONY and also IIS_IUSRS and allow them the Full control to the folder. Just to check if that will help. Nope, it won't.
2)在IIS管理器中,我试图改变应用程序的默认池标识(依据一href=\"http://$c$czest.com/archive/2009/12/14/system.unauthorizedaccessexception-access-to-the-path-is-denied.aspx\"相对=nofollow>这)我检查了所有选项,但没有成功。
2) in the IIS Manager, I tried to change the Application's Pool Defaults Identity (based on that) I checked all options, with no success
我不知道该怎么做更多来解决它。任何想法?
I don't know what to do more to fix it. Any ideas ?
推荐答案
请注明IIS的操作系统和版本。
Please state your operating system and version of IIS.
您需要授予访问运行在IIS中的应用程序池的帐户。它通常是NT AUTHORITY \\ Network服务,所以尽量给予完全控制该帐户。
You need to grant access to the account that is running the app-pool in IIS. It is usually NT Authority\Network Service, so try granting full control to that account.
不过,如果你正在使用Windows集成安全性(并有模拟= TRUE)在您的网站,也必须被授予访问权限的用户,是请求页面的用户。
However, if you are using windows integrated security (and have impersonation=true) on your website, the user that must be granted access, is the user requesting the page.
最后,我真的想从拍动态创建ASPX文件的博客系统阻止你。它根本就没有做到这一点。
Finally, I really want to discourage you from making a blog system that creates aspx files on the fly. It's simply not the way to do it.
这篇关于问题错误:&QUOT;访问路径&LT;路径&GT;被拒绝&QUOT。的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!